Florida Entity Maintenance Essentials

Preserving a Florida business entity needs diligent adherence to state requirements to make sure recurring compliance and legal standing. Routine declaring of yearly reports is necessary for corporations, LLCs, and various other entities, typically due by May 1st every year, and failing to do so can lead to charges or management dissolution. It's critical to keep exact records of business members, supervisors, and registered representatives, updating them with the Florida Division of State when modifications take place. Company licenses and licenses may additionally need renewal occasionally, relying on the nature of procedures and neighborhood regulations. Additionally, maintaining correct tax obligation records and submitting essential federal and state tax obligation returns are crucial components of continuous compliance. Remaining educated about any kind of legal updates or adjustments in declaring fees assists avoid unintentional violations. Proper entity maintenance not just protects limited responsibility securities but additionally makes certain business continues to be in good standing, facilitating smooth procedures and potential growth chances in Florida's dynamic industry.
